Jan 1, 2025·Strategic Plan

City of Schertz Capital Improvement Program 2025-2035

Strategic

This document outlines the City of Schertz's 10-year Capital Improvement Program (CIP), detailing projects to be funded by available revenue and debt sources. The plan encompasses improvements across key infrastructure categories: Water, Sewer, Streets, Drainage, Parks, and Facilities. It provides descriptions, locations, and funding timelines for projects, with a focus on addressing infrastructure wear, frequency of use, and community impact, particularly concerning health and public safety. The program reflects the annual budget for FY 2025-26 and outlines expenditures extending to FY 2031-2035.

Aug 19, 2025·Board Meeting

City of Schertz, Texas Adopted Annual Budget

Board

The City Council presented the Proposed Budget for Fiscal Year 25-26, which includes an Operating Budget and a Capital Budget. The budget focuses on staff compensation, street maintenance and repair, the Capital Improvement Program (CIP), increasing staffing levels, and new and remodeled facilities. It addresses economic conditions, fiscal challenges such as the Disabled Veteran's Homestead Exemption (DVHS) program, and adjustments to revenue forecasts. The budget also details new positions added across various funds, including the General Fund, Water & Sewer Fund, EMS Fund, and Drainage Fund. Challenges in meeting budget goals include loss of property value, funding for EMS, and drainage fees.

Oct 2, 2024·Board Meeting

Schertz Planning And Zoning Meeting

Board

The meeting included a call to order, consideration of the minutes from the September 4th, 2024 meeting, and four public hearings. The first public hearing involved a request to rezone approximately 218 acres of land from agricultural district to accommodate a development agreement. The second public hearing involved a request to rezone approximately 1.4 acres of land from office and professional district to neighborhood services district to develop an automated car wash. The Planning and Zoning commission recommended approval for the first rezoning request and denial for the second rezoning request.
